blob: 2cf60daaf310dfa8e58b595f770e9dff347337a0 [file] [log] [blame]
.travis.yml | 39 -
.travisCI/runPrecheck.sh | 35 -
.travisCI/travisBuild.sh | 28 -
OpenFPGA_task/arch/fabric_key.xml | 678 +
OpenFPGA_task/arch/openfpga_arch.xml | 253 +
OpenFPGA_task/arch/vpr_arch.xml | 677 +
OpenFPGA_task/config/task.conf | 39 +
OpenFPGA_task/config/task_generation.conf | 39 +
OpenFPGA_task/config/task_simulation.conf | 33 +
OpenFPGA_task/design_variables.yml | 1 +
OpenFPGA_task/generate_fabric.openfpga | 57 +
OpenFPGA_task/generate_testbench.openfpga | 70 +
OpenFPGA_task/micro_benchmark/and.act | 3 +
OpenFPGA_task/micro_benchmark/and.blif | 8 +
OpenFPGA_task/micro_benchmark/and.v | 14 +
OpenFPGA_task/process_top_def.sh | 46 +
OpenFPGA_task/sc_verilog/digital_io_hd.v | 55 +
OpenFPGA_task/sc_verilog/fpga_top.v | 422 +
OpenFPGA_task/user_project_wrapper_empty.def | 1219 +
OpenFPGA_task/user_project_wrapper_template.def | 3768 +
README.md | 158 +-
checks/caravel.magic.drc | 104 +
checks/caravel.magic.drc.mag | 80938 ++++++++++++++
checks/caravel.magic.namelist | 1 +
checks/caravel.magic.rdb | 63 +
checks/caravel.magic.typelist | 1 +
checks/compare_caravel.txt | 0
checks/full_log.log | 57 +
checks/magic_drc.log | 11264 ++
checks/magic_extract.log | 38691 +++++++
checks/magic_merge_user_project_wrapper.log | 11417 ++
checks/manifest_check.mag.log | 2 +
checks/manifest_check.maglef.log | 13 +
checks/manifest_check.rtl.log | 37 +
checks/mprj.magic.namelist | 1 +
checks/mprj.magic.typelist | 1 +
checks/spdx_compliance_report.log | 110 +
gds/caravel.gds.gz | Bin 52991493 -> 63058241 bytes
gds/user_proj_example.gds.gz | Bin 742584 -> 0 bytes
gds/user_project_wrapper.gds.gz | Bin 6394035 -> 4982990 bytes
gds/user_project_wrapper_empty.gds.gz | Bin 73084 -> 0 bytes
info.yaml | 20 +-
mag/.magicrc | 16 -
qflow/digital_pll_controller/tech | 1 -
qflow/ring_osc2x13/tech | 1 -
source_commit_hash.txt | 14 +
verilog/OpenFPGA_Verilog/InstancesMap.txt | 1 +
verilog/OpenFPGA_Verilog/define_simulation.v | 18 +
verilog/OpenFPGA_Verilog/fabric_netlists.v | 67 +
verilog/OpenFPGA_Verilog/fpga_core.v | 45804 ++++++++
verilog/OpenFPGA_Verilog/fpga_defines.v | 16 +
verilog/OpenFPGA_Verilog/fpga_top.v | 39515 +++++++
verilog/OpenFPGA_Verilog/lb/grid_clb.v | 226 +
.../lb/logical_tile_clb_mode_clb_.v | 619 +
.../lb/logical_tile_clb_mode_default__fle.v | 139 +
...e_clb_mode_default__fle_mode_physical__fabric.v | 206 +
...t__fle_mode_physical__fabric_mode_default__ff.v | 56 +
...ode_physical__fabric_mode_default__frac_logic.v | 98 +
...e_default__frac_logic_mode_default__frac_lut4.v | 70 +
.../OpenFPGA_Verilog/lb/logical_tile_io_mode_io_.v | 82 +
.../lb/logical_tile_io_mode_physical__iopad.v | 75 +
verilog/OpenFPGA_Verilog/routing/cbx_1__0_.v | 480 +
verilog/OpenFPGA_Verilog/routing/cbx_1__1_.v | 593 +
verilog/OpenFPGA_Verilog/routing/cbx_1__2_.v | 512 +
verilog/OpenFPGA_Verilog/routing/cby_0__1_.v | 113 +
verilog/OpenFPGA_Verilog/routing/cby_1__1_.v | 583 +
verilog/OpenFPGA_Verilog/routing/cby_2__1_.v | 515 +
verilog/OpenFPGA_Verilog/routing/sb_0__0_.v | 603 +
verilog/OpenFPGA_Verilog/routing/sb_0__1_.v | 823 +
verilog/OpenFPGA_Verilog/routing/sb_0__2_.v | 606 +
verilog/OpenFPGA_Verilog/routing/sb_1__0_.v | 762 +
verilog/OpenFPGA_Verilog/routing/sb_1__1_.v | 981 +
verilog/OpenFPGA_Verilog/routing/sb_1__2_.v | 732 +
verilog/OpenFPGA_Verilog/routing/sb_2__0_.v | 831 +
verilog/OpenFPGA_Verilog/routing/sb_2__1_.v | 839 +
verilog/OpenFPGA_Verilog/routing/sb_2__2_.v | 856 +
verilog/OpenFPGA_Verilog/sub_module/arch_encoder.v | 10 +
.../OpenFPGA_Verilog/sub_module/digital_io_hd.v | 55 +
verilog/OpenFPGA_Verilog/sub_module/fpga_top.v | 422 +
.../OpenFPGA_Verilog/sub_module/inv_buf_passgate.v | 42 +
.../OpenFPGA_Verilog/sub_module/local_encoder.v | 10 +
verilog/OpenFPGA_Verilog/sub_module/luts.v | 107 +
verilog/OpenFPGA_Verilog/sub_module/memories.v | 825 +
verilog/OpenFPGA_Verilog/sub_module/muxes.v | 1397 +
verilog/OpenFPGA_Verilog/sub_module/wires.v | 34 +
verilog/OpenFPGA_Verilog/top_include_netlists.v | 31 +
verilog/gl/caravel_sofa_hd_top.v | 100340 ++++++++++++++++++
87 files changed, 350215 insertions(+), 273 deletions(-)